Don't know if there is supposed to be a trick to these dang things in but I couldn't seem to get the couple I tried this afternoon. When I pulled my stock ones they definitely took some effort to get out. The new ones are delphi 42's for my 98 TA.
What's the trick to getting these in? Yes I searched, it's my friend :eyes:


quicksilverado
03-03-2008, 06:53 PM
I use a small dab of motor oil on the o-rings and they pop right in.

I'm preparing to do an injector install as well, lookin at the 42# delphi lucas injectors. After installation, am I going to need to retune?

ZV8
03-06-2008, 08:42 AM
I'm preparing to do an injector install as well, lookin at the 42# delphi lucas injectors. After installation, am I going to need to retune?

Yes, if you have the 26 or 28lb stock injectors you will need a retune or you will run super rich and may mess up the engine!
